The table below provides summary statistics and salary benchmarking for jobs advertised in Manchester requiring AngularJS skills. It covers permanent job vacancies from the 6 months leading up to 14 September 2026, with comparisons to the same periods in the previous two years.

6 months to
14 Sep 2026
Same period 2025 Same period 2024
Rank 128 125 76
Rank change year-on-year -3 -49 +9
Permanent jobs citing AngularJS 72 32 116
As % of all permanent jobs in Manchester 0.98% 1.34% 2.86%
As % of the Libraries, Frameworks & Software Standards category 9.46% 5.61% 11.26%
Number of salaries quoted 42 24 41
10th Percentile £47,625 £52,875 £36,250
25th Percentile £55,000 £56,875 £46,250
Median annual salary (50th Percentile) £70,000 £66,250 £60,000
Median % change year-on-year +5.66% +10.42% +9.09%
75th Percentile £81,250 £77,500 £68,750
90th Percentile £93,750 £86,750 £80,000
North West median annual salary £67,500 £63,750 £54,000
% change year-on-year +5.88% +18.06% -1.82%
